I am looking for some advice on an insert for my somewhat odd firebox size.

I have a fireplace with dimensions which make it difficult for me to find an insert/stove that will fit properly.

Just some background.. The fireplace is constructed of fieldstone.. At some point (I believe the 70's), the fieldstone facing into the room was covered with manufactured stone. This "build out" of the original fireplace has left me with a rather large lintel - 16" wide.

I currently have a Jotul F100 installed in the fireplace opening and is vented through the rear outlet. The F100 was one of the only freestanding stoves that would fit the opening. (The fireplace opening is 23.5" H x 28.5" W x 33" D)

While the Jotul is doing a good job, the tiny firebox is killing me. It requires regular attention and it only fits 16" logs.

The height and width dimensions arent a problem - it's the size of the lintel...

Does anyone have an suggestions on an insert that might fit? I'd also be fine with a larger freestanding stove, but it would need to fit the height/width dimensions of the fireplace.. I don't have the space to mount it outside of the fireplace...
